Ball Aerospace, founded in 1969, is a leading aerospace technology firm that engineers advanced satellite systems, space‑borne sensors, and defense solutions for NASA, commercial space, and national security customers. The company is celebrated for its high‑precision attitude control systems, propulsion subsystems, and cutting‑edge optical payloads that power missions such as the James Webb Space Telescope and numerous CubeSat initiatives.

Hiring at Ball Aerospace spans a wide range of technical and programmatic roles. Engineers—mechanical, electrical, software, systems, and avionics—work on propulsion, attitude control, and sensor integration. Program managers, test engineers, quality assurance specialists, and data science analysts support mission planning, flight operations, and data processing. Candidates can expect rigorous technical interviews, collaborative cross‑disciplinary teams, and the chance to contribute to high‑impact space and defense projects.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is it like to work at Ball Aerospace?
Employees describe a collaborative engineering culture focused on solving complex space and defense problems. Teams work on multi‑disciplinary projects, from propulsion design to optical instrumentation. Career development includes formal mentorship, technical training, and opportunities to work on high‑visibility missions such as NASA’s Earth Explorer series.
What types of positions are available at Ball Aerospace?
The company hires across engineering (mechanical, electrical, software, avionics, and systems), program management, test & quality assurance, data science, manufacturing, and IT roles. Many positions involve satellite subsystem design, flight‑test integration, mission operations, or data analytics for space mission data.
How can I stand out as an applicant?
Tailor your resume to the specific mission focus of the job, highlight relevant certifications (e.g., Six Sigma, PMP, or aerospace engineering credentials), and provide quantitative examples of past project contributions. Prepare for technical case studies by studying Ball Aerospace product lines and practicing problem‑solving under time constraints. Networking with current employees through LinkedIn or industry conferences can also strengthen your application.
